Manhattan Bridge A/D/E

Please do something about the rooftop camping on Manhattan Bridge.

This camping on the A and E site as well as on top of D is really killing the map flow.

You have no ability as an infantry without the Helicopter to counter this cause you can‘t get there with ropes or ladders. I don‘t even get why u can‘t get on top of D from the first floor in this building. Everything is blocked. 

Make it possible to get there via ropes like on B. Otherwise this is going out of hand every round.

  • Thank you for your feedback. Totally understand that when certain rooftop positions lack effective counterplay, it can impact the overall balance between offense and defense.

    The team has been continuously reviewing and adjusting similar high-ground scenarios. For example,

    Update 1.1.3.0

    • Adjusted Conquest and Escalation capture areas on Manhattan Bridge so objectives can no longer be captured from rooftop positions.
    • Extended rooftop out-of-bounds areas on Empire State, Manhattan Bridge, and Saints Quarter.

    Update 1.2.1.0

    • Fixed an issue in Sabotage where attackers could reach elevated positions and spawn-camp the defending team on Blackwell Fields.
    • Fixed an issue on Siege of Cairo where players could reach the top of buildings in Sector D3 using the Deployable Cover gadget.
    • On Manhattan Bridge, fixed an issue where players could stand on top of the bridge, creating unintended gameplay advantages.
    • On Empire State, fixed an issue where players could capture Point B (Sector 2) on Breakthrough from an unintended upper floor.

    Regarding your point about the current gameplay on Manhattan Bridge, I’ll pass this along to the team so they can review it in the context of the intended design.
